Не работает Shellinabox

Обсуждение установки и настройки поддерживаемых вебсерверов, а также работы с ними.
hrumx
Сообщения: 9
Зарегистрирован: Пт фев 01, 2019 12:59 am

Не работает Shellinabox

Сообщение hrumx » Вт фев 05, 2019 7:13 pm

В разделе "Приложения - WebShell" пустая страница (как под root так и под другими пользователями). В менеджере приложений нет возможности удаления или переустановки Shellinabox. Висит "Идёт процесс", перезапуск не помогает.
Пробовал переустановить приложение через консоль:
удалил:
rpm -e shellinabox
установил:
yum install shellinabox
запустил:
systemctl enable shellinaboxd.service
systemctl start shellinaboxd.service
Это не помогло. Очевидно, проблема не в пакете Shellinabox. Что делать?
Вложения
2.png
2.png (19.38 КБ) 18454 просмотра
1.png
1.png (37.88 КБ) 18454 просмотра

Аватара пользователя
alenka
Сообщения: 2194
Зарегистрирован: Ср сен 27, 2017 11:10 am

Re: Не работает Shellinabox

Сообщение alenka » Ср фев 06, 2019 8:21 am

Shellinabox ставится исключительно через панель, там отрабатывает скрипт
/etc/brainy/ssh/packet_manager/shellinabox/shellinabox.sh

Удалите все сторонние репозитарии потом yum clean all, и переустановите shellinaboxчерез панель.

Если доступ к вебконсоли через webpanel, и установлена связка nginx, или nginx+apache, переустановите данную связку,
так как nginx в ранних версиях панели был без поддержки авторизации

Аватара пользователя
ordex
Сообщения: 353
Зарегистрирован: Вт ноя 20, 2018 2:47 pm

Re: Не работает Shellinabox

Сообщение ordex » Вт фев 26, 2019 8:34 am

А у меня не появляется в меню пункт webshell у пользователей, только под рутом ( shell включен и у хост-группы стоят разрешающие права на вебшелл).
А дальше самое интересное, если вручную под пользователем перейти в ?do=shellinabox то консолька запускается, но с правами рута :)
Это ОЧЕНЬ весело, но удалил я её нафиг от греха подальше.

Аватара пользователя
alenka
Сообщения: 2194
Зарегистрирован: Ср сен 27, 2017 11:10 am

Re: Не работает Shellinabox

Сообщение alenka » Вт фев 26, 2019 9:30 am

Поправили, будет доступно в ближайшем обновлении.

Аватара пользователя
ordex
Сообщения: 353
Зарегистрирован: Вт ноя 20, 2018 2:47 pm

Re: Не работает Shellinabox

Сообщение ordex » Вс мар 03, 2019 8:45 am

Теперь у пользователей вообще не появляется пункт web-консоль. Если вбивать ссылку вручную то "нет доступа" и у тех у кого шелл включен и у тех у кого выключен.
Вроде бы в "Группы хост-аккаунтов -> Пользовательские" был пункт отвечающий за доступность web-shell. Или нет? Где в таком случае это настраивается?

Аватара пользователя
alenka
Сообщения: 2194
Зарегистрирован: Ср сен 27, 2017 11:10 am

Re: Не работает Shellinabox

Сообщение alenka » Пн мар 04, 2019 7:59 am

Теперь у пользователей вообще не появляется пункт web-консоль
shellinabox в данный момент работает с дополнительной http аутентификацией.
В рамках безопасности веб консоль у пользователей отключена.

pr0g
Сообщения: 8
Зарегистрирован: Вт июл 30, 2019 7:32 am

Re: Не работает Shellinabox

Сообщение pr0g » Вт июл 30, 2019 8:56 am

alenka писал(а):
Пн мар 04, 2019 7:59 am
shellinabox в данный момент работает с дополнительной http аутентификацией.
В рамках безопасности веб консоль у пользователей отключена.
Хочу спросить:
На текущий момент доступ к Web Shell доступен только для учетной записи root?
Я отключил доступ к root и делегировал права другому пользователю и у этого пользователя нет доступа к разделу Web Shell.

Аватара пользователя
alenka
Сообщения: 2194
Зарегистрирован: Ср сен 27, 2017 11:10 am

Re: Не работает Shellinabox

Сообщение alenka » Пн авг 12, 2019 7:21 am

Здравствуйте.
shellinabox для всех пользователей заблокирован.

ukrainer
Сообщения: 21
Зарегистрирован: Сб июн 29, 2019 10:58 pm

Re: Не работает Shellinabox

Сообщение ukrainer » Сб авг 17, 2019 10:06 pm

alenka писал(а):
Ср фев 06, 2019 8:21 am
Shellinabox ставится исключительно через панель, там отрабатывает скрипт
/etc/brainy/ssh/packet_manager/shellinabox/shellinabox.sh

Удалите все сторонние репозитарии потом yum clean all, и переустановите shellinaboxчерез панель.

Если доступ к вебконсоли через webpanel, и установлена связка nginx, или nginx+apache, переустановите данную связку,
так как nginx в ранних версиях панели был без поддержки авторизации
У меня та же история... удалил шелину, почистил кеш и установил снова через панель, но безрезультатно. Также не помогла переустановка звязки nginx+apache

При этом, такая же история с ClamAV и ClamSMTP (установлены но индикация оповещает о их неработоспособности). Все это появилось после какого то с последних автоматических обновлений панели. Может есть еще какие решения?

Аватара пользователя
sbury
Сообщения: 1463
Зарегистрирован: Вт фев 06, 2018 7:51 am

Re: Не работает Shellinabox

Сообщение sbury » Вт авг 20, 2019 12:58 pm

а если посмотреть через консоль

systemctl status shellinaboxd.service -l

он запущен?

Ответить